Food processing is the transformation of cooked ingredients, by physical or chemical means into food, or of food into other forms.Food processing combines raw food ingredients to produce marketable food products that can be easily prepared and served by the consumer.. Food processors take raw animal, vegetable, or marine materials and transform them into edible products through the application of labor, machinery, energy, and scientific knowledge. Foods with low pH values (below 4.5) are usually not readily spoiled by bacteria and are more susceptible to spoilage by yeast and molds. The Chinese and Greeks used salted fish in their diet, and therefore the Greeks are credited with passing this practice on to the Romans, whose diet included pickled meats. Typical yeast cells range from 5 to eight m in diameter, with some being even larger. Milk, butter, and cheese were employed by the Egyptians as early as 3000 bc. In 2019, the International Scientific Association for Probiotics and Prebiotics (ISAPP) convened a panel of experts specializing in nutrition, microbial physiology, gastroenterology, paediatrics, food science and microbiology to review the definition and scope of postbiotics.
